Review recap.

You can tell why Avicebron sided with Shirou in the opening of the episode. Just like him, his goal is to save the world, so why wouldn’t he side with the person who will give him a chance at bringing Eden to the world. He was a misanthropist, something that Shirou also seemed to be given that he considered Sieg becoming more like a person or Servant as a downgrade, but they both seemed to have the same idea in mind, fulfilling it in their own ways.

Mordred also seemed to share some kinship with Sieg in this episode, being pretty buddy-buddy with him despite trying to kill him a few episodes ago. Then again, she can probably relate to him considering her backstory. Her MVP status remains unsullied though, and it’s looking like she’s going to be in it for the long-haul.
